Wisely I installed one of these so I can drain the outlet pipe from macerator . Had a few times where I need to drain it . Problem is this cap leaks - it’s just a screw cap with a washer . I’ve tightened with grips but can’t really go any further . Are all end caps equal ? . Nothing I can smear round the thread that will make a water tight seal but won’t glue the cap on !!? . I did think of plumbers tape - but it’s too awkward to get to …

Take my new robot vac . Couldn’t get it to connect to my WiFi. No idea of the issue - no error message except fail Googling … only apparently connects to 2.4gz not 5 . Mines both with band steering . So I disable 5ghz - still doesn’t work . How would you explain how to do that to someone without a lot of detail ? Google more . Apparently for reasons unknown doesn’t like a router address of 192.168.8.1 - exactly what I have . So I change that ; which naturally breaks everything else . Explaining how to do that would be very difficult if the person you are explaining it to is just following your commands . That thought gets it working ! - shame everything else is bust though due to router IP change … -
